Fuel cell flow field optimization based on fractal nature inspired patterns

Supervisor: Natalya Kizilova

Different designs based on simplified theoretical computations for the fractal channel systems for gas delivery to the next generation of H2 fuel cells. CFD computations (AnSys Fluent) of the flow parameters on the optimal design and the performance estimation.
The proposed topic is within a cooperative project with Norway team and in the case of successful work the student will be invited for a short stay at NTNU (Trondheim, Norway).
